Transaction 959dbd7366f43a10629457955a15c7699af9bad9666a8bb62278b01cae401e05

1 Input
2 Outputs
  • 959dbd7366f43a10629457955a15c7699af9bad9666a8bb62278b01cae401e05:0
  • value  1061700
    address  37vAsZDFABm8myr2oM2WPMMLGpVUwPjc1G
  • 959dbd7366f43a10629457955a15c7699af9bad9666a8bb62278b01cae401e05:1
  • value  4992511
    address  3ECmK5HULyGFGTHVcHc6UKoPB33KrcRLvj